Abstract

Language:

Three-dimensional sand printing (3DSP) is an emerging additive manufacturing (AM) process with the potential to produce complex casting molds that were previously unfeasible with traditional methods. However, the casting volume is limited due to the size constraints of 3DSP printing. This study presents a modular, joinery-based, self-interlocking 3DSP casting mold system designed to overcome these limitations while minimizing traditional casting mold restraints. The efficacy of the mold system was illustrated through the metalcasting of an A356.2 aluminum alloy cylinder using varying parameterizations of a dovetail joint design. Relevant casting metrics, including volume, percent volume of excess material (mold flash), and volumetric shrinkage, were statistically analyzed to assess the impact of joinery design on the quality and characteristics of both the 3DSP molds and the resulting metalcastings. The analyses revealed that the joint design parameters—specifically the angle of the mold-mating faces and their length—had minimal effects on the volume of flash, shrinkage, and density. Conversely, the joint design significantly influenced the ease of assembly. The outcomes from this study will facilitate the development of larger-than-printable, complex, multi-piece self-interlocking casting molds without degrading the quality of the resulting metalcastings.
